Responsibilities
- Assist in planning and preparing work schedules and assign colleagues to specific duties.
- Help ensure the financial performance of the center.
- Develop and maintain policies, procedures, and training programs for the center.
- Participate in hiring, training, and evaluating center staff in collaboration with HR.
- Support the Center Operations Director in HR activities and staff management.
- Review operational reports and schedules for accuracy and efficiency.
- Assist in budget preparation and review.
- Participate in on-site tours, training, and presentation of clinic services.
- Provide technical support and resources to clients and staff.
- Manage on-site nursing services, including billing and supervision.
- Ensure medical testing compliance and certifications.
- Monitor market trends and gather competitive info.
- Coordinate with vendors for services and supplies, ensuring productivity and customer service.
- Participate in continuous improvement projects based on performance metrics.
- Maintain a professional and welcoming environment for patients and colleagues.
- Lead by example in daily operations and patient care.
- Assist with financial oversight in the absence of the Center Operations Director.
Qualifications
- Some college courses in Business or Healthcare Administration preferred.
- Bachelor’s degree in related field or equivalent work experience preferred.
- At least one year of management experience.
- Minimum six months healthcare experience.
